|
|
马上注册,结识高手,享用更多资源,轻松玩转三维网社区。
您需要 登录 才可以下载或查看,没有帐号?注册
x
+ P+ L- V3 k7 j症状8 z% t& t3 C7 B7 r* w8 ?0 s
从8月份以来,安装与升级SOLIDWORKS会发现运行不稳定,受影响的软件为) m% e) n O; y/ }. m% a: h
SOLIDWORKS 2011 - 2015, 和 SOLIDWORKS 2016.$ ]2 K6 d+ F! E) @ ~- X
已知的症状是:( ~% y0 H% u* x! B' r& p* C
• 工具菜单中插件列表中丢失插件
% Y) T, X: u: E% f3 i1 D- X3 C, E• 开启SOLIDWORKS或者打开文件时显示错误"不能加载SOLIDWORKS DLL: GdtAnalysisSupport.dll"0 R6 e Q& `8 T
• 录制,运行或者编辑SOLIDWORKS宏文件时出现崩溃0 }* ^+ ]6 v: B
• 使用方程时不稳定
0 k/ d- f# S: U* @• 开启SOLIDWORKS或者SOLIDWORKS Explorer出现错误: "DWG 文档管理器库文件无效或者丢失"9 y( \5 @5 O5 q: k8 |3 F, _7 g
不稳定可能会发生在软件的多个不同的功能领域,因此以上列表未必完整。
5 r* i7 f1 _' f5 ^" x- P; U( t原因:: J8 P2 p# I% j! s" L8 W
Microsoft KB3072630 发布于2015年7月14号,安装或者升级KB3072630会导致微软与SOLIDWORKS冲突,最终引起SOLIDWORKS的不稳定。微软的更新改变了 Windows Installer,进而阻止了SOLIDWORKS正确的执行安装(新安装,修改/修复,更新或者卸载)。我们正努力的致力于尽快在SOLIDWORKS 2015和2016中修复这个问题,然而修复过程中请参阅以下内容以防止和改正冲突引发的不稳定。! s; j: K0 _2 k$ M0 u f
解决办法
9 R/ A* {* }' V1 ~! }9 Y0 `. X$ A首先确认您是否安装了 KB3072630:
8 }7 {& `1 y4 L: I1. 在Windows控制面板中,点击Windows更新菜单。
5 S' T( x+ u. U" P2 C2. 在左边面板中,点击查看更新历史。
( N' c& d6 W! G) B* u5 `3. 浏览已经安装的更新,检查 KB3072630是否已经安装。如果出现了 KB3072630,应该是在2015年7月14号或者之后被安装的。9 ?* y2 e6 ^# d$ q4 e
4. 如果 KB3072630已经被安装在您的系统中,请根据各自适合的场景参阅推荐的方案。. `; n Q \8 C. e. ~7 y4 Q
8 t- a2 T: \ \ ]重要提示:我们不推荐卸载KB3072630 ,因为它是重要的安全更新。下一步的操作,请查看以下。
8 ~4 ]* P; }/ \4 M0 d' t重要提示:如果您对注册表做出了不正确的改变,可能会导致严重的问题。我们建议您在操作之前事先备份注册表 这里。我们建议您在进行以下操作的时候与IT管理员一起合作。
6 X5 o& ]2 C Y8 Q场景1
9 P; a5 i" u+ e4 L7 ^2 ~* Y# V在 KB3072630应用以后没有安装或者更新SOLIDWORKS的用户,为了阻止问题的发生,我们建议您在安装或者更新SOLIDWORKS之前暂时不启用KB3072630:
$ ~' _. o# V3 X/ b2 j C% E1. 或者是通过以下步骤 (a)-(f) ,或者双击这里KB3072630_Disable.reg。 3 Y, p9 ]( g3 H* C& ~
a. 点击 开始, 点击运行, 在打开窗口输入"regedit", 点击OK* k, P3 ^+ x- w0 ^. d- M
b. 在注册表中找到以下子表:9 W' t7 o$ v% n- z" k7 }
HKEY_LOCAL_MACHINE\SOFTWARE\Policies\Microsoft\Windows\Installer' C2 C8 S5 p2 J8 T7 e
注意:如果这个词条不存在,请创建这个子表+ o# O! b) `0 R$ m8 [6 N
c. 在编辑菜单中, 指向新建, 并且选择DWORD Value
0 b, ?: M# q( y' ?3 V! W d. 对于DWORD的名字, 输入"RemappedElevatedProxiesPolicy", 并且回车
6 G4 ~5 M$ O3 C3 w/ ` e. 右键点击RemappedElevatedProxiesPolicy, 并且选择修改
. u% M7 {1 }! K& d' R f. 在值 的窗口中, 输入 1, 并点击OK
* L- {' b" E; l# L2 ]5 V/ R2. 正常安装,更新或者卸载SOLIDWORKS5 Q% T* }3 f D$ @
3. SOLIDWORKS安装或者更新成功之后,将RemappedElevatedProxiesPolicy 的DWORD值重新设置为0并且重新启用KB3072630
8 f! z* R( ?! \7 q- U/ a
, v8 I& i( X3 I4 X5 `- ?+ }& O场景2
+ n# z! O, f6 O3 _0 A; X在KB3072630已经应用,并且已经安装或者更新了SOLIDWORKS的用户,其中使用本地源文件办法安装SOLIDWORKS的用户。您的安装会倾向于不稳定,并且随后的安装会不成功。我们推荐以下办法修复您的安装:
?9 x. b1 i4 O9 C' s- W1. 使用场景1中的步骤17 Q$ W/ B! `2 Q8 t- Z, T
2. 在Windows的控制面板中选择程序和功能对SOLIDWORKS进行修复安装,选择更改, 再选择修复安装,最后根据屏幕上的提示一步步点击下去3 r- W W$ V9 B# Y' X. q: f4 N
3. 在SOLIDWORKS修复安装之后,将RemappedElevatedProxiesPolicy 值重新设置为0并且重新启用KB3072630" H# c/ v u. g6 F, V6 h$ B
3 {9 ?$ s' S% a- m5 M场景3: L# U5 E4 [( V; K& c
在KB3072630已经应用,并且已经安装或者更新了SOLIDWORKS的用户,其中使用安装管理程序安装的用户。您的SOLIDWORKS安装倾向于不稳定。有必要卸载SOLIDWORKS,我们推荐以下的步骤:) Z7 U5 Y* ^+ M5 ?4 D; T" }
1. 在Windows的控制面板的程序和功能菜单中卸载SOLIDWORKS。找到SOLIDWORKS并选择卸载
5 q; b' E/ c% @& L+ P! {( x2. 使用场景1中的步骤1& X) ]$ x3 F9 G& {5 g
3. 使用您的安装管理程序安装SOLIDWORKS/ f* E: ?' N) j$ p2 N- P5 T1 r
4. SOLIDWORKS安装完成之后,将RemappedElevatedProxiesPolicy DWORD值重新设置为 0并且重新启用KB307263 Y( Z# j4 z5 A' o& D4 D7 x
|
评分
-
查看全部评分
|